Han J.A. Mensink is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Han J.A. Mensink has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 647 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 8 papers in Surgery and 5 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Han J.A. Mensink's work include Renal cell carcinoma treatment (6 papers), Renal and related cancers (4 papers) and Sexual function and dysfunction studies (3 papers). Han J.A. Mensink is often cited by papers focused on Renal cell carcinoma treatment (6 papers), Renal and related cancers (4 papers) and Sexual function and dysfunction studies (3 papers). Han J.A. Mensink coll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ands, Denmark and Sweden. Han J.A. Mensink's co-authors include Igle J. de Jong, Willem Vaalburg, Jan Pruim, Philip H. Elsinga, Sverker Hellsten, Joaquı́n Carballido, Harald Schulze, G. Mickisch, Siebe D. Bos and Jan A.M. Kremer and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Urology, International Journal of Cancer and European Urology.
